Bailleul (Belle in Dutch) is a small commune of the Nord département, in France, located near Lille. It has 17,191 inhabitants including its nearby hamlets. The commune includes a historic building, schools and two colleges. Bailleul is the birthplace of French filmmaker Bruno Dumont and served as the setting for his first two feature films.
